目录前言材料ESP-01S连接网页流程一、ESP-01S初始化一、设定一些重要的变量二、初始化串口三、整理上面代码,整合成函数(ESP-01S模块初始化)二、相关函数准备一、关于串口函数二、关于数据校验三、延时函数三、连接上WIFI(热点)四、连接上网址五、运行测试六、运行结果总结前言主要记录下我学习ESP-01S的时候遇到的困难,和一些细节错误。供大家参考和借鉴。当时我在学时,我就一直在搜索百度
ESP8266网页web交互界面arduino的菜单库https://github.com/neu-rah/ArduinoMenu自带生成html界面https://github.com/Hieromon/PageBuilderstar很多的esp固件https://github.com/arendst/TasmotaESP UIhttps://github.com/s00500/ESPUI方法
转载 2024-05-09 10:06:45
372阅读
一、效果二、基础例程HTTP服务基于examples\protocols\http_server\advanced_tests WIFI扫描基于https://github.com/espressif/esp-idf/tree/master/examples/wifi/scan AP配置基于ESP8266_RTOS_SDK\examples\wifi\getting_started\softAP
转载 2024-02-23 17:54:35
265阅读
准备工作   准备一个深圳四博智联科技有限公司的ESP-F 模组。或者四博智联科技的NODEMCU         当我们拿到ESP-F模块后,可以按照以下接线进行测试:   即 VCC、EN 接 3.3v、GPIO15 GND 接地、模块的 TX、RX 接串口工具的 RX、TX、RST
ESP8266_遥控小车网页版话不多说,上代码不懂的地方可以看这篇文章里面介绍的非常详细了这里不多赘述回家 3 天,我做了一辆远程遥控小车#include <ESP8266WiFi.h> // 本程序使用 ESP8266WiFi库 #include <ESP8266WiFiMulti.h> // ESP8266WiFiMulti库 #include &l
转载 2024-04-23 11:28:58
176阅读
本系列博客学习由非官方人员 半颗心脏 潜心所力所写,仅仅做个人技术交流分享,不做任何商业用途。如有不对之处,请留言,本人及时更改。① 对物联网爱不释手,在Android手机集成使用MQTT协议 ,实现搞掂移动控制硬件端。① 新年新气象,封装一个esp8266一键配XSmartConfig , 支持自定义回调。一. 前言。之前逛gitHub,有人问过是否支持自定义回调8266的信息,我想应该可以把
转载 2024-08-25 17:11:05
84阅读
一、网页控制原理Esp8266相当于作为一个web服务器,当我连接wifi后通过外部设备输入相应的IP,esp8266进行解析,将存储在8266,falsh中的网页读取并显示出来,当我点击网页上的按钮后,8266进行解析,控制灯亮。网页与服务器之间使用Get/POST协议。8266设置AP模式,建立wifi热点创建TCP_server,建立帧听等待clientl连接server,等待接收数据根据接
转载 2024-03-28 06:58:19
319阅读
1.前言废话少说,本篇博文的目的就是深入学习 WifiManager 这个github上非常火爆的ESP8266 web配库,让初学者不再对web配感到迷茫,并且通过学习第三方库来自定义自己的web配功能。等你学习整篇博文,你会发现 So easy!!2.WiFiManager2.1 WiFiManager源码地址直接点击 github 下载代码2.2 WiFiManager是什么一句话概括
转载 2024-05-28 11:41:11
742阅读
MicroPython_ESP8266_IoT——第五回 网页配置(局域连接WiFi)参考官方手册中,对network库的介绍:network——network configuration 。建议在REPL中,通过命令行逐个熟悉提示到的方法,加深理解。network模块介绍此模块提供网络连接的驱动,以及路由配置。配置网络后,可以通过usocket模块获取网络服务。使用起来非常方便,官教程中也给
下载本次ESP8266 MCU开发项目之一键式配  代码文件流程图讲解视频展示效果 配ESP8266 项目可待 改进/升级 的地方1:配流程UI界面单调,可搭配复杂UI配界面2:配流程可看作是WIFI放大器实现的一个操作步骤,可继续开发成为WIFI放大器,可配合天线,PCB板子等,制作出来WIFI放大器。3:配流程简单,可作为一些基础代码,继续开发科实现一些远程控制(局
上篇文章我们了解了ESP8266到底是个什么“东西”,了解了ESP8266在这个万物互联时代有哪些优势,那我们不能光是了解,我们还需要去深入的学习一下,争做物联网时代的弄潮儿~继往开来第二篇,本篇文章主要介绍一下几种常见的ESP8266开发方式,感觉现在不管是学习硬件开发还是软件开发,第一节课都是先学习一下开发环境搭建,毕竟这个开发环境不单单是有台电脑就足够了,交叉编译工具链才是最重要的,我们需要
关于ESP8266的配模式,本人实际接触到的配有smartconfig和零配模式1、smartconfig配需要用户输入热点的SSID和密码,实际上就是手机端、路由器和通信模块三者之间的一种交互方式,在短时间内,是一种相对稳定和安全的方式,让通信模块连接上指定的路由器,进而获取上网的流量,具体详细请自行了解smartconfig工作原理等。2、零配相比smartconfig而言就方便很多
转载 2024-02-23 11:10:13
221阅读
目录MicroPython开发环境配置(ESP8266开发板)基础环境IDE串口驱动代码烧录工具REPL交互式解析环境交互环境工具REPL快捷键 MicroPython开发环境配置(ESP8266开发板)书接上回,买回来了Eruopa开发板(esp8266芯片),咱先把开发环境给搭建起来。这块开发板卖家有送一个名叫“Jupter”的在线IDE环境账号,可以在浏览器中直接查看教程、编写代码、烧录板
转载 2024-08-01 12:46:07
150阅读
1. 多个WIFI接入点设置2.web启动与基本访问设置#include <ESP8266WiFi.h> // 本程序使用 ESP8266WiFi库 #include <ESP8266WiFiMulti.h> // ESP8266WiFiMulti库 #include <ESP8266WebServer.h> // ESP8266Web
转载 2024-05-17 13:08:46
389阅读
因为今天终于做好了自己的另一块工控板,所以我就开始写基础公开篇的内容,希望自己小小的努力能够帮到大家自己做的另一块板子前几节咱使用的是没有操作系统的SDK,,后面咱再使用带操作系统的SDK来学习开发,我的风格是综合,综合,综合,就是WIFI+上位机+Android+网页等等什么的一块学,都是一步一步的实现.不过不用担心,绝对不会让大家感觉难的....全是基础所有的源码也是全部公开https://g
Author:teacherXue一、ESP8266接入网络前面我们已经可以使用nodemcu来读取传感器数据,或者控制外设。但这些功能和普通的单片机没有本质差别。物联网是需要接入网络的,传统的单片机系统还需要其他的设备中转才能互相连接以及访问公网。而ESP8266自带wifi功能,其本身就能充当智能网关的角色,ESP32芯片更是提供了蓝牙功能。固定SSID以STA身份接入在有路由器的场合,mcu
写在前面: 本文章旨在总结备份、方便以后查询,由于是个人总结,如有不对,欢迎指正;另外,内容大部分来自网络、书籍、和各类手册,如若侵权请告知,马上删帖致歉。 无需安装,直接点开就能用了,启动后就可以看到下图那样因为我们是用 8266,所以点第一个,如果你是用 8285或者 esp32,点对应的就好了;点进去里面后就会出现一个全新的界面了,然后我们主要分析里面的配置,对后面我们编译出来的
转载 2024-03-26 23:51:52
252阅读
STM32通过ESP8266利用机智云平台实现手机远程操作将STM32作为主控芯片,ESP8266作为外设,利用串口传递信息,通过机智云平台实现STM32与手机之间的数据传输!之所以选择机智云平台,是因为机智云平台相关配套的软件工具非常齐全,而且和正点合作,按照原子哥的精神推出有详细的基于STM32的教程,非常适合对云服务的认知处于一脸懵的人对其进行初步的探索。 其实原子哥的东西很详细,但是总得自
前言每次下班回到家就已经很累了,到门口还要到处翻找钥匙,然后开门,是不是觉得很烦,那我们有没有不用通过钥匙开门且成本低的方案了?下面我会教大家基于ESP8266+点灯科技+小爱同学来控制开门的方法一、准备工作1、硬件材料①、ESP8266开发板(均价13R) ②、SG90 MG90S 9g舵机(均价12R) ③、电源模块 5V (均价2R) ④、杜邦线(母头和公对母)、DC 5.5x2.1 DC0
这可是零知ESP8266的硬核知识哦,因为ESP8266其本身是一个WiFi模块,那么使用它的WiFi功能就是最基本的啦首先第一步:配置网络。了解SmartConfig与Airkiss一键配,给ESP8266一键配网上云端。当你拿到一块WiFi模块,如果需要连上网络,则需要将SSID名称、密码设置到模块当中。一般有几种方式:①就是通过串口接到输入设备,通过串口输入AT指令(SSID名称和密码);
  • 1
  • 2
  • 3
  • 4
  • 5